BuildRequires: java-dom4j >= 1.6.1
BuildRequires: java-gnu-regexp >= 1.1.4
BuildRequires: java-httpunit >= 1.6
+BuildRequires: java-jaxen >= 1.1
BuildRequires: java-jdom >= 1.0
BuildRequires: java-junit >= 3.8.2
BuildRequires: java-oro >= 2.0.8
BuildRequires: checkstyle4 >= 4.1
BuildRequires: checkstyle4-optional >= 4.1
BuildRequires: classworlds >= 1.1
-BuildRequires: jaxen >= 1.1
#BuildRequires: jmock >= 1.0.1
BuildRequires: jline >= 0.8.1
BuildRequires: jsch >= 0.1.20
%package javadoc
Summary: Javadoc for %{name}
Group: Development/Documentation
-Requires(post): /bin/rm,/bin/ln
-Requires(postun): /bin/rm
%description javadoc
%{summary}.
Requires: ant >= 1.6.5
Requires: ant-junit
Requires: ant-nodeps
-Requires: junit >= 3.8.2
+Requires: java-junit >= 3.8.2
Requires: maven-wagon >= 1.0-0.1.b2
Requires: plexus-utils >= 1.2
-Requires: xalan-j2 >= 2.6.0
+Requires: java-xalan >= 2.6.0
Requires: xml-commons-apis >= 1.3.02
Requires: plexus-container-default
Requires: %{name} = %{version}-%{release}
Requires: maven-shared-plugin-testing-tools
Requires: maven-shared-test-tools
Requires: jmock >= 1.0.1
-Requires: jdom >= 1.0
-Requires: jaxen >= 1.1
+Requires: java-jdom >= 1.0
+Requires: java-jaxen >= 1.1
Requires: saxpath
-Requires: junit >= 3.8.2
+Requires: java-junit >= 3.8.2
%description plugin-assembly
Builds an assembly (distribution) of sources and/or binaries.
Requires: plexus-velocity >= 1.1.2
Requires: plexus-mail-sender
Requires: glassfish-javamail
-Requires: jakarta-commons-lang
+Requires: java-commons-lang
Requires: velocity
Requires: maven-shared-reporting-impl
%package plugin-clean
Summary: Clean plugin for maven
Group: Development/Build Tools
-Requires: junit >= 3.8.2
+Requires: java-junit >= 3.8.2
Requires: %{name} = %{version}-%{release}
Requires(postun): %{name} = %{version}-%{release}
Requires: plexus-utils >= 1.2
Requires: plexus-archiver >= 1.0
Requires: plexus-utils >= 1.2
Requires: maven-shared-file-management >= 1.0-4
-Requires: junit >= 3.8.2
+Requires: java-junit >= 3.8.2
Requires: plexus-container-default
Requires: maven-shared-dependency-analyzer
Requires: maven-shared-dependency-tree
Requires: maven-shared-plugin-tools-beanshell >= 2.2
Requires: maven-shared-plugin-tools-java >= 2.2
Requires: commons-httpclient
-Requires: jakarta-commons-logging >= 1.0.4
+Requires: java-commons-logging >= 1.0.4
Requires: maven-shared-file-management >= 1.0-4
Requires: maven-shared-plugin-tools-api
Requires: maven-shared-reporting-impl
Requires(postun): %{name} = %{version}-%{release}
Requires: plexus-utils >= 1.2
Requires: maven-shared-verifier
-Requires: xmlunit
+Requires: java-xmlunit
%description plugin-ear
Generates an EAR from the current project.
Requires: plexus-utils >= 1.2
Requires: plexus-archiver >= 1.0
Requires: jmock >= 1.0.1
-Requires: jdom >= 1.0
-Requires: jaxen >= 1.1
+Requires: java-jdom >= 1.0
+Requires: java-jaxen >= 1.1
Requires: saxpath
Requires: plexus-interactivity >= 1.0
Requires: maven-shared-plugin-testing-tools
Group: Development/Build Tools
Requires: %{name} = %{version}-%{release}
Requires(postun): %{name} = %{version}-%{release}
-Requires: jakarta-commons-lang
+Requires: java-commons-lang
Requires: plexus-utils
-Requires: jakarta-commons-lang
-Requires: junit >= 3.8.2
+Requires: java-commons-lang
+Requires: java-junit >= 3.8.2
%description plugin-gpg
The Maven GPG Plugin signs all of the project's attached artifacts with GnuPG.
%package plugin-idea
Summary: Idea plugin for maven
Group: Development/Build Tools
-Requires: dom4j >= 1.6.1
+Requires: java-dom4j >= 1.6.1
Requires: %{name} = %{version}-%{release}
Requires(postun): %{name} = %{version}-%{release}
Requires: maven-wagon >= 1.0-0.1.b2
Requires: maven-shared-file-management >= 1.0-4
Requires: maven-shared-io
%endif
-Requires: bsh
+Requires: java-bsh
%description plugin-invoker
The Maven Invoker Plugin is used to run a set of Maven projects and makes
%package plugin-jar
Summary: Jar plugin for maven
Group: Development/Build Tools
-Requires: jakarta-commons-lang >= 2.1
+Requires: java-commons-lang >= 2.1
Requires: %{name} = %{version}-%{release}
Requires: maven-shared-archiver >= 2.3
Requires(postun): %{name} = %{version}-%{release}
%package plugin-javadoc
Summary: Javadoc plugin for maven
Group: Development/Build Tools
-Requires: jakarta-commons-lang >= 2.1
+Requires: java-commons-lang >= 2.1
Requires: %{name} = %{version}-%{release}
Requires(postun): %{name} = %{version}-%{release}
%if %{without bootstrap}
%package plugin-one
Summary: One plugin for maven
Group: Development/Build Tools
-Requires: junit >= 3.8.2
+Requires: java-junit >= 3.8.2
Requires: %{name} = %{version}-%{release}
Requires(postun): %{name} = %{version}-%{release}
Requires: plexus-archiver >= 1.0
Requires: plexus-utils >= 1.2
-Requires: junit >= 3.8.2
+Requires: java-junit >= 3.8.2
Requires: maven-shared-model-converter
%description plugin-one
Requires: plexus-utils >= 1.2
Requires: plexus-resources
Requires: pmd >= 3.3
-Requires: jaxen >= 1.1
-Requires: xom
+Requires: java-jaxen >= 1.1
+Requires: java-xom
Requires: maven-shared-reporting-impl
%description plugin-pmd
%package plugin-project-info-reports
Summary: Project-info-reports plugin for maven
Group: Development/Build Tools
-Requires: httpunit >= 1.6
-Requires: jakarta-commons-validator >= 1.1.4
+Requires: java-httpunit >= 1.6
+Requires: java-commons-validator >= 1.1.4
Requires: %{name} = %{version}-%{release}
Requires(postun): %{name} = %{version}-%{release}
Requires: plexus-i18n >= 1.0
%package plugin-remote-resources
Summary: Remote Resources plugin for maven
Group: Development/Build Tools
-Requires: junit >= 3.8.2
+Requires: java-junit >= 3.8.2
Requires: %{name} = %{version}-%{release}
Requires(postun): %{name} = %{version}-%{release}
Requires: plexus-container-default
%package plugin-repository
Summary: Repository plugin for maven
Group: Development/Build Tools
-Requires: junit >= 3.8.2
+Requires: java-junit >= 3.8.2
Requires: %{name} = %{version}-%{release}
Requires(postun): %{name} = %{version}-%{release}
Requires: plexus-archiver >= 1.0
%package plugin-resources
Summary: Resources plugin for maven
Group: Development/Build Tools
-#Requires: jakarta-commons-io >= 1.1
+#Requires: java-commons-io >= 1.1
Requires: plexus-utils >= 1.2
Requires: %{name} = %{version}-%{release}
Requires(postun): %{name} = %{version}-%{release}
Requires: plexus-archiver >= 1.0
Requires: plexus-utils >= 1.2
Requires: plexus-container-default >= 1.0
-Requires: junit >= 3.8.2
+Requires: java-junit >= 3.8.2
%description plugin-source
Builds a JAR of sources for use in IDEs and distribution to the repository.
Requires(postun): %{name} = %{version}-%{release}
Requires: maven-wagon
Requires: plexus-utils
-Requires: junit >= 3.8.2
+Requires: java-junit >= 3.8.2
%description plugin-stage
Maven Stage Plugin copies artifacts from one repository to another.
%package plugin-verifier
Summary: Verifier plugin for maven
Group: Development/Build Tools
-Requires: junit >= 3.8.2
+Requires: java-junit >= 3.8.2
Requires: %{name} = %{version}-%{release}
Requires(postun): %{name} = %{version}-%{release}
%if %{without bootstrap}
Requires: %{name} = %{version}-%{release}
Requires(postun): %{name} = %{version}-%{release}
Requires: plexus-utils >= 1.2
-Requires: junit >= 3.8.2
+Requires: java-junit >= 3.8.2
%description plugin-war
Builds a WAR from the current project.